The FDA And Food Defect Action Levels
The U.S. Food and Drug Administration (FDA) manages something called Food Defect Action Levels (FDALs). These are maximum limits for unavoidable natural defects.
The goal is to ensure food safety for mass production. The levels are set well below any threshold that could cause harm.
For pre-ground coffee, the FDA action level is an average of 10% or more insect-infested beans by count. This refers to beans visibly damaged by insects, not a measure of pure insect content.
It’s a quality control standard. It helps ensure that manufacturers follow good processing practices to minimize contamination.
Common Defects in Other Foods
To put this in perspective, many common foods have similar FDA defect levels. This shows how widespread the practice of managing natural contaminants is.
- Chocolate: Allows an average of 60 insect fragments per 100 grams.
- Peanut Butter: Allows an average of 30 insect fragments per 100 grams.
- Wheat Flour: Allows an average of 75 insect fragments per 50 grams.
- Canned Mushrooms: Allows an average of 20 maggots of any size per 100 grams.
These levels are considered safe for consumption and are a practical part of global food supply chains.

The Coffee Production And Roasting Process
Understanding how coffee gets from farm to cup clarifies where insects might enter the equation. It also shows the steps that remove or minimize them.
- Harvesting: Coffee cherries are picked by hand or machine. In the field, insects are naturally present on the plants.
- Processing: The bean is removed from the fruit. This often involves fermentation and washing, which can remove some foreign material.
- Drying and Storage: Beans are dried on patios or in mechanical dryers. They are then stored in sacks or silos, which can be vulnerable to pests if not secure.
- Roasting: This is the most critical step. Beans are exposed to temperatures between 370°F and 540°F. This incinerates any whole insects and sterilizes the beans.
- Grinding and Packaging: After roasting, beans are ground and packaged. This is a final point where cross-contamination could occur if equipment is not clean.
The intense heat of roasting is a key safety step. It destroys pathogens and makes any remaining microscopic fragments biologically inert.
Whole Bean Vs. Pre-Ground Coffee
Your choice between whole bean and pre-ground coffee can influence the potential for insect-related defects. The processing difference is significant.
Whole bean coffee typically undergoes less handling after roasting. You grind it yourself just before brewing, which reduces opportunities for contamination in the final product.
Pre-ground coffee is processed in large industrial grinders. While these are cleaned regularly, the grinding process for vast quantities means that insect fragments from a small number of infested beans can be dispersed throughout a large batch.
This is one reason the FDA’s defect level specifically addresses pre-ground coffee. The grinding makes visual inspection of individual beans impossible.

Health Implications and Allergen Concerns
For the vast majority of people, the microscopic insect material allowed in coffee poses zero health risk. The fragments are not toxic and are processed by the body like any other organic particle.
The high-temperature roasting ensures they are sterile. The FDA’s limits are set with a large margin of safety far below any conceivable harmful level.
Shellfish And Dust Mite Allergies
A specific health consideration involves allergies. Cockroaches, like shellfish and dust mites, contain a protein called tropomyosin.
Some individuals with severe shellfish or dust mite allergies may theoretically react to insect fragments in food. This is because the protein structure is similar.
Cases of this are extremely rare and documented in medical literature primarily concerning intentional insect consumption, not trace contaminants. If you have a severe known allergy, consulting an allergist is always wise, but there is no widespread advisory against coffee for allergy sufferers.
The roasting process may also denature these proteins, reducing their allergenic potential. More research is needed in this specific area, but general risk is considered very low.

How Coffee Companies Ensure Quality
Responsible coffee companies implement stringent supply chain controls to minimize defects. Their brand reputation depends on delivering a clean, consistent product.
Many follow standards that exceed the FDA’s minimum requirements. They invest in technology and processes to keep your coffee as pure as possible.
Common Quality Control Measures
- Supplier Audits: Companies audit their farms and processing facilities for hygiene and pest control practices.
- Sorting Technology: Optical sorters use cameras and air jets to remove defective beans, including those with insect damage, by color and shape.
- Sanitary Storage: Beans are stored in pest-proof containers and facilities with controlled temperature and humidity.
- Regular Testing: Samples from batches are tested in labs for various contaminants, including insect fragments.
- Certifications: Some brands seek third-party certifications (like USDA Organic) which have their own strict handling protocols.
